Benefits of Oral Implants



Lots of elders locate that dental implants offer a life-changing solution for missing teeth. Unlike dentures, which can move and cause pain, oral implants give a secure and secure alternative. You can eat your favored foods without stressing over your teeth slipping or relocating. This newfound self-confidence can enhance your overall quality of life.

An additional significant benefit is the natural appearance of dental implants. They're created to mix perfectly with your existing teeth, allowing you to grin freely without really feeling self-conscious.

Plus, they help maintain your jawbone density. When you lose teeth, the bone can start to deteriorate, yet implants stimulate the bone, avoiding further loss and helping protect your facial framework.

Furthermore, dental implants need much less maintenance than dentures. You won't need to eliminate them for cleaning; simply brush and floss as you usually would. This simplicity of treatment can be a big advantage for senior citizens.

Considerations for Senior citizens



While oral implants offer various advantages, there are essential factors to consider senior citizens need to bear in mind prior to waging this choice.

Initially, your overall health plays an important duty. Conditions like diabetes mellitus, osteoporosis, or heart problems can influence healing and make complex the treatment. It's essential to seek advice from your doctor to guarantee you're an ideal candidate.



Next off, think about the price. Dental implants can be costly, and insurance policy protection differs. Make certain you understand your monetary obligations and check out repayment options if required.

Additionally, consider your dental health regimen. Implants require attentive care to stop infection and make sure durability.

One more variable is the moment dedication involved. The process can take several months from assessment to final positioning, so you'll require to plan as necessary.

Last but not least, assess your way of life. If you have wheelchair issues or find it tough to attend follow-up consultations, dental implants may not be the best choice for you.

The Implant Treatment Process



Recognizing the dental implant procedure process is crucial for elders considering this dental alternative. The journey normally starts with an appointment where your dentist evaluates your dental health and discusses your goals. They might take X-rays or scans to ensure you're an appropriate candidate for implants.

When you're accepted, the first step of the treatment includes putting the titanium dental implant into your jawbone. This is done under local anesthetic, so you will not really feel pain throughout the procedure.

After the dental implant is placed, it's critical to allow a recovery duration of a couple of months. During this time around, the implant fuses with your bone-- a procedure known as osseointegration.
